pachysandra
Noun
-
subtypes:
- allegheny mountain spurge, allegheny spurge, pachysandra procumbens - low semi-evergreen perennial herb having small spikes of white or pinkish flowers; native to southern United States but grown elsewhere
- japanese spurge, pachysandra terminalis - slow-growing Japanese evergreen subshrub having terminal spikes of white flowers; grown as a ground cover
belongs to: genus pachysandra - evergreen perennial procumbent subshrubs or herbs
